Applied Psychophysiology and Biofeedback is the official publication of the Association for Applied Psychophysiology and Biofeedback (AAPB).
The AAPB, a non-profit organization, was founded in 1969 as the Biofeedback Research Society. AAPB's mission is to advance the development, dissemination and utilization of knowledge about applied psychophysiology and biofeedback to improve health and the quality of life through research, education and practice.
